10.4.1.6 show ipv6 ospf database database-summary
This command displays the number of each type of LSA in the database and the total number of LSAs in
the database.
Default Setting
None
Command Mode
Privileged Exec
User Exec
Display Messages
Router: Total number of router L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Network: Total number of network L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Inter-area Prefix: Total number of inter-area prefix L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Inter-area Router: Total number of inter-area router L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Type-7 Ext: Total number of NSSA external L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Link: Total number of link L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Intra-area Prefix: Total number of intra-area prefix L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Link Unknown: Total number of link-source unknown L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Area Unknown: Total number of area unknown L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
AS Unknown: Total number of as unknown L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Type-5 Ext: Total number of AS external L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
Self-Originated Type-5: Total number of self originated AS external LSAs in the OSPFv3
link state database.
Total: Total number of router LSAs in the OSPFv3 link state database.
